Polyurethane Rosette

Polure polyurethane rosettes deliver exquisite ceiling centerpieces, decorative wall medallions, light fixture medallions, and architectural relief accents for grand interior spaces. Manufactured from high-density rigid polyurethane (150-220 kg/m³), this ornamental medallion provides timber-like structural sharpness without the fragility of traditional plaster or gypsum. Featuring closed-cell composition with under 1% water absorption, it will not rot, swell, distort, or foster mold in humid dining rooms or master suites. Engineered to perform in temperatures from -100 °C / +80 °C with B2 fire safety compliance, every rosette comes factory-coated with a white acrylic technical primer. Anchor to ceilings or wall surfaces using continuous polyurethane assembly adhesive paired with countersunk mechanical screws into drywall or joists. Sand lightly (180-220 grit) and coat with water-based interior paint.

Frequently Asked Questions

What material is used in the Polure polyurethane rosette?

The Polure polyurethane rosette is manufactured from high-density rigid polyurethane (150-220 kg/m³), providing wood-like sharpness and a B2 fire rating.

Can a polyurethane rosette be installed around a chandelier or light fixture?

Yes, it can easily be drilled or center-cut with standard woodworking tools to accommodate light fixture electrical wiring.

How is a polyurethane rosette mounted on the ceiling?

It is installed using continuous polyurethane assembly adhesive on rear contact surfaces combined with mechanical screws into ceiling joists or drywall plugs. Silicone is forbidden.

What paint should be applied to a polyurethane rosette?

Apply water-based acrylic interior paint after lightly sanding the factory white primer with 180-220 grit paper.
